alethic  (adj.)

A term derived from modal logic and used by some LINGUISTS as part of a theoretical framework for the analysis of MODAL VERBS and related STRUCTURES in LANGUAGE. Alethic modality is concerned with the necessary or contingent truth of propositions, e.g. the use of the modal in the sentence A triangle must have three sides, i.e. ‘It is impossible for a triangle not to have three sides.’ It contrasts with EPISTEMIC and DEONTIC modality, which are concerned with obligation and knowledge, respectively.
